Common Pain Points in Current Irrigation Valve Systems

Industrial and agricultural irrigation systems in Yakima face unique operational challenges:
Leakage at Connection Points: Poor sealing materials cause water loss, increasing operational costs and reducing system efficiency.
UV Degradation: Prolonged exposure to high-intensity sunlight causes plastic components to crack and fail prematurely.
Solenoid Reliability Issues: Frequent coil burnouts and inconsistent actuation lead to system downtime and inconsistent irrigation scheduling.
Pressure Rating Failures: Valves not rated for PN16 can fail under pressure surges, causing catastrophic system damage and costly repairs.

Material Specifications & Compliance

All materials are certified to global standards with corrosion-resistant finishes for long-term reliability:
Cast Iron: ASTM A126 Grade B, Class 300, epoxy-coated for soil and UV exposure resistance.
Ductile Iron: ASTM A536 Grade 65-45-12, fusion-bonded epoxy (FBE) coating for superior abrasion and chemical resistance.
Stainless Steel: AISI 304/316L, fully passivated to prevent pitting in chlorinated or saline water systems.
